SDCC 2017 – First Look at Return of Rocko’s Modern Life

By VeronicaJuly 21, 2017
Rocko

Last month, Nickelodeon revealed that Invader Zim, Hey Arnold, and Rocko’s Modern Life would each return for their own hour-long special. Today at Comic Con, we got a sneak peak at Rocko’s Modern Life: Static Cling:

The preview makes tons of jokes about the new century since the show ended back in ’96. The sneak peak features everything from iPhones and 3D printers to food trucks. Still, it so far manages to feel like the original Rocko series with that familiar B-52’s theme song playing in the background. Fans will also be happy to know that the original cast are reprising their roles, and series creator Joe Murray is involved in the TV movie.

Static Cling will premiere on Nickelodeon sometime in 2018.
